Krleža, Miroslav, 1893–1981, Croatian novelist, playwright, and poet. He captured the concerns of a revolutionary era in Yugoslavia in his trilogy of social dramas about the Glembay family (1928–32) and in novels like The Return of Philip Latinovicz (1932) and Banners (1963–65), a multivolume saga of the Croatian bourgeoisie beginning in the early 20th cent.
